يمكنك تضمين متغير ديناميكي في رسالتك أثناء الرد على جهة اتصال. هناك طريقتان لاستخدام المتغيرات الديناميكية:
بكتابة الدولار علامة "$"
عن طريق النقر على أيقونة المتغير في أسفل وحدة صندوق الوارد
بالإضافة إلى حقول جهات الاتصال، يمكنك أيضًا تضمين حقل مخصص عن طريق كتابة الحقل المخصص'اسم s
أثناء تكوين محتوى كتلة كتلة كتلة كتلة كتلة كتلة كود's، يمكنك تضمين متغير ديناميكي لتخصيص ردودك السريعة.
نصيحة: يمكنك الحصول على متغيرات ديناميكية متعددة في قطعة واحدة من المحتوى. استخدمها أثناء تكوين رسائلك.
تحذير: إذا كان الحقل الذي تحاول إرساله فارغًا أو غير موجود على الإطلاق، فلن يتم استبدال السلسلة.
وبالإضافة إلى المتغيرات المشغلة والمرتبطة بمشغل محدد، هناك أيضا متغيرات أخرى يمكن إنشاؤها واستخدامها في سير العمل.
حفظ الردود من جهة الاتصال كمتغيرات في خطوة اسأل سؤالا.
ثم استخدم المتغيرات الديناميكية المحفوظة في خطوات سير العمل.
خطوات سير العمل التي تدعم المتغيرات الديناميكية
خطوة | نوع |
---|---|
إرسال رسالة | نص |
إرسال رسالة | قالب WhatsApp |
إرسال رسالة | رسالة علامة Facebook |
اطرح سؤالًا | حقل نص السؤال |
فرع | حالة حقل الاتصال |
فرع | حالة المتغير |
تحديث حقل جهة الاتصال | - |
إضافة تعليق | - |
إغلاق المحادثة | ملخص |
طلب HTTP | - |
إضافة صف Google Sheets | - |
ملاحظة: عند التحقق من طلب HTTP المخرجات مع المتغيرات الديناميكية، يرجى ملاحظة أن المتغيرات التي لا قيمة لها ستؤدي إلى إرجاع
ull
أوغير محددة
.
يمكنك أيضًا تضمين المتغيرات الديناميكية في Dialogflow للردود وقيم معلمات . لاستخدام المتغير الديناميكي في Dialogflow، اكتب undefined}
.
مثال على استخدام المتغيرات الدينامية في قيمة البارامترات:
مثال على استخدام المتغيرات الدينامية في الاستجابات:
إذا كنت تقوم بدمج المتغيرات الديناميكية باستخدام API المطور، تأكد من تنسيقها بشكل صحيح باستخدام الأقواس المزدوجة undefined. وعلى سبيل المثال:
undefined
وهذا مطلوب لتمكين API من معالجة واستبدال المتغيرات كما هو معتزم.
ملاحظة: للحصول على تعليمات وأمثلة مفصلة، يرجى الرجوع إلى وثائق API المطور.